Servings: 8
Serving Size: 1 Cup Pasta
Calories: 368
Fat: 8 g
Carbs: 38 g
Fiber: 4.5 g
Protein: 31 g
Points+: 9
Old Points: 7

Here Are Your Ingredients:
4 large boneless skinless chicken breasts
1 large tomato - diced
4 fresh basil leafs - diced
2 garlic - crushed
1 tablespoon dijion mustard
2 egg whites
25 Reduced Fat Ritz Crackers - crushed
12 ounces whole wheat bow tie noodles
Pam (or any non stick cooking spray)
1/4 cup low fat milk
1 1/2 cups mozzarella - part skim
1/4 cup diced deli turkey meat
Bake noodles according to box. Dip chicken breasts in egg whites then in Ritz cracker crumbs. Spray large skillet with pam and place coated chicken breasts in. Cook on medium heat for 6 minutes on each side. When noodles are done drain. Preheat oven to broil. With same pan you used for noodles add milk, mustard, garlic, basil, and tomatoes. Let simmer for about 10 minutes. Now add cheese to sauce mix together completely. When chicken is done take out and slice. Now place deli meat in pan you cooked chicken in and slightly brown/ warm for 2-3 minutes. When deli meat is warmed add to sauce mixture. With casserole dish first add noodles, then chicken and top with sauce. Now place in oven for 5 minutes!
